Onsite wastewater system maintenance and repair play an important position in ensuring that sewage treatment processes remain environment friendly and environmentally friendly. These systems are often used in areas where municipal sewage methods are unavailable. Regular maintenance can considerably extend the life of such techniques and stop expensive repairs.


Proper maintenance includes a routine inspection, which allows householders to identify potential problems earlier than they escalate. Key elements typically inspected embody septic tanks, drain fields, and effluent filters. Recognizing the signs of system failure may be vital for making timely repairs.


Neglecting maintenance can lead to critical points like sewage backups and environmental contamination. Householders should pay attention to any modifications of their techniques, similar to slow drainage or foul odors, as these can indicate underlying problems. Well Timed motion is essential to avoid extra extreme issues that may come up from neglect.

In addition to regular inspections, routine pumping of septic tanks is an integral a part of wastewater system maintenance. This course of removes amassed solids, stopping them from clogging the system. Specialists generally suggest pumping each three to five years, however this will differ based on system dimension and household usage.


The effluent filter, if present, additionally requires attention. These filters can get clogged with solids and debris, resulting in system malfunctions. Common cleaning of the filter helps preserve water quality and prevents costly repairs.


One Other crucial side of onsite wastewater system maintenance issues the drain area. This area is answerable for the absorption and treatment of wastewater. Householders ought to observe their drain fields for signs of trouble, corresponding to wet spots or lush vegetation, which might indicate system failure.






Repairing a drain field may be complex and expensive. Several methods exist for repairing or changing a failing drain subject, including including further drain strains, installing a mound system, or implementing trenches. Choosing the appropriate method is decided by the precise scenario and may involve session with professionals.

When it involves repairs, understanding when to name in an skilled is crucial. Many issues with onsite wastewater techniques may seem minor, however they will shortly escalate into main problems. Owners mustn't hesitate to hunt advice in the event that they discover anything unusual, as immediate repairs can reduce harm.


In regions with heavy rainfall or flooding, onsite wastewater methods could be notably weak. Extra water can overload techniques, resulting in backups and compromises in the treatment course of. Owners should be vigilant during wet seasons and take preventive measures when attainable.


The function of education can't be overstated in maintaining onsite wastewater systems. Owners should familiarize themselves with their system's operation and appropriate maintenance practices. This proactive method may help mitigate potential issues and improve the system's longevity.


Proper landscaping across the system can even contribute to its maintenance. Planting trees and shrubs too near the system can result in root intrusion, compromising the efficacy of wastewater treatment. Owners should consider buffer zones or panorama options that promote drainage away from the system.

An onsite wastewater system, commonly generally identified as a septic system, is a self-contained underground wastewater treatment system that processes and disposes of sewage on the property where it originates. It sometimes consists of a septic tank, soil absorption subject, and different parts that work collectively to treat visit this site right here wastewater.


How often should I even have my onsite wastewater system inspected?


It is recommended to have your onsite wastewater system inspected at least once every three years by a professional professional. Nevertheless, you might need more frequent inspections based on usage, system design, and native regulations. Common inspections assist establish potential points early and guarantee your system operates efficiently.


What are widespread signs that my onsite wastewater system needs repair?

Frequent signs embody slow draining sinks and bogs, gurgling sounds in plumbing, wet or soggy areas close to the drain area, or unpleasant odors around the system. Noticing these symptoms can point out a potential failure within the system, requiring quick consideration.


What should I do if my septic system is backing up?

If your septic system is backing up, refrain from using water fixtures and make contact with an expert immediately. A backup can point out a blockage or malfunction, and immediate motion might help prevent extra extensive harm and expensive repairs.

Sure, most jurisdictions require a permit for repairs or modifications to onsite wastewater methods. It ensures that the work adheres to local health and safety regulations. Be positive to verify with your native health division or authority before endeavor any repairs.


How a lot does it cost to maintain or repair an onsite wastewater system?


Prices can vary considerably primarily based on the extent of maintenance needed or repairs required. Routine inspections may range from $150 to $300, while major repairs might cost 1000's. Acquiring estimates from licensed professionals can provide a clearer image of potential expenses.
